ABOUT US
Austin Fitness Group (AFG) is a leading Franchisor and Area Developer of Orangetheory Fitness studios. As the second largest Orangetheory franchise group, the AFG team owns and operates 63 Orangetheory Fitness studios across six markets. Orangetheory is a science-based, efficient 1-hour, full-body workout experience. Orangetheory's unique approach combines heart rate zone training with strength exercises, providing participants with a personalized fitness journey within a motivating group setting.

JOB OVERVIEW
Austin Fitness Group is currently seeking a seasoned and dynamic Controller to join our team. In this key leadership role, you will be responsible for overseeing the Payroll and Accounting functions, playing a pivotal role in financial management within our fast-paced and ever-evolving organization. Reporting directly to the SVP of Finance, the Controller will contribute to financial management and team leadership.

DUTIES/RESPONSIBILITIES:
· Oversee all accounting processes, suggesting improvements for best practice & scalability.
· Direct timely monthly and annual accounting close processes in compliance with GAAP.
· Prepare consolidated financial statements for board meetings and ongoing bank requirements.
· Ensure consistent accounting policies and procedures across all business areas.
· Develop and enforce internal controls to maximize protection of company assets, policies, procedures, and workflows.
· Oversee Payroll department and processes, including variable compensation plans.
· Ensure all aspects of tax reporting are filed timely and accurately, coordinating with tax professionals and regulatory agencies as needed.
· Direct all audits, including the annual financial audit and ancillary audits such as workers compensation and payroll.
· Manage insurance and banking relationships.
· Oversee and support accounting team with dynamic leadership that creates an environment of trust and productivity, with a focus on coaching and mentoring.
· Provide technical guidance and leadership to own team as well as other Managers and Functions on issues relating to accounting or accounting dependencies.
